A line's slope is -3, and its y-intercept is 0. What is its equation in slope-intercept form?

Answer:

y = -3x

General Formulas and Concepts:

Algebra I

Slope-Intercept Form: y = mx + b

  • m - slope
  • b - y-intercept

Step-by-step explanation:

Step 1: Define

Slope m = -3

y-intercept b = 0

Step 2: Write function

y = -3x
